import numpy as np
import tensorflow as tf
import tensorflow.keras.backend as K
from sklearn.model_selection import train_test_split
from sklearn.pipeline import make_pipeline
from sklearn.preprocessing import StandardScaler
from sklearn.svm import SVC
from tensorflow import keras
from tensorflow.keras import layers
from utils import prepare_data
def label_classifier(latents, labels, num=200):
np.random.seed(1)
x_train, x_test, y_train, y_test = train_test_split(latents[0], labels,
test_size=0.5, random_state=1)
clf = make_pipeline(StandardScaler(), SVC())
clf.fit(x_train[0:num], y_train[0:num])
score = clf.score(x_test, y_test)
return score
class DecodingHistory(keras.callbacks.Callback):
def __init__(self, dataset):
_, self.test_data, _, _, _, self.test_labels = prepare_data(dataset, labels=True)
self.decoding_history = []
def on_epoch_begin(self, epoch, logs=None):
latents = self.model.encoder.predict(self.test_data)
score = label_classifier(latents, self.test_labels)
self.decoding_history.append(score)
class Sampling(layers.Layer):
# Uses (z_mean, z_log_var) to sample z, the vector encoding a digit.
def call(self, inputs):
z_mean, z_log_var = inputs
batch = tf.shape(z_mean)[0]
dim = tf.shape(z_mean)[1]
epsilon = tf.keras.backend.random_normal(shape=(batch, dim))
return z_mean + tf.exp(0.5 * z_log_var) * epsilon
def encoder_network_large(input_shape, latent_dim=100):
input_img = layers.Input(shape=input_shape)
x = layers.Dropout(0.2, input_shape=input_shape)(input_img)
x = layers.Conv2D(32, 4, strides=(2, 2))(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(64, 4, strides=(2, 2))(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(128, 4, strides=(2, 2))(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(256, 4, strides=(2, 2))(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.GlobalAveragePooling2D()(x)
z_mean = layers.Dense(latent_dim, name='mean')(x)
z_log_var = layers.Dense(latent_dim)(x)
z = Sampling()([z_mean, z_log_var])
encoder = keras.Model(input_img, [z_mean, z_log_var, z], name="encoder")
return encoder, z_mean, z_log_var
def decoder_network_large(latent_dim=100):
decoder_input = layers.Input(shape=(latent_dim,))
x = layers.Dense(4096)(decoder_input)
x = layers.Reshape((4, 4, 256))(x)
x = layers.UpSampling2D((2, 2), interpolation='nearest')(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(128, 3, strides=1, padding='same')(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.UpSampling2D((2, 2), interpolation='nearest')(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(64, 3, strides=1, padding='same')(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.UpSampling2D((2, 2), interpolation='nearest')(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(32, 3, strides=1, padding='same')(x)
x = layers.BatchNormalization()(x)
x = layers.LeakyReLU()(x)
x = layers.UpSampling2D((2, 2), interpolation='nearest')(x)
x = layers.Conv2D(3, 3, strides=1, padding='same', activation='sigmoid')(x)
decoder = keras.Model(decoder_input, x)
return decoder
def build_encoder_decoder_large(latent_dim=5):
input_shape = (64, 64, 3)
encoder, z_mean, z_log_var = encoder_network_large(input_shape, latent_dim)
decoder = decoder_network_large(latent_dim)
return encoder, decoder
def kl_loss_fn(z_mean, z_log_var, kl_weighting):
# take the sum across the n latent variables
# then take the mean across the batch
kl = K.mean(-0.5 * K.sum(1 + z_log_var \
- K.square(z_mean) \
- K.exp(z_log_var), axis=-1))
return kl_weighting * kl
def reconstruction_loss_fn(x, t_decoded):
# mean_absolute_error() returns result of dim (n_in_batch, pixels)
# take the sum across the 64x64x3 pixels
# take the mean across the batch
data = x
reconstruction = t_decoded
# note that binary_crossentropy loss also gives good results
reconstruction_loss = tf.reduce_mean(tf.reduce_sum(
keras.losses.mean_absolute_error(data, reconstruction), axis=(1, 2)))
return reconstruction_loss
class VAE(keras.Model):
def __init__(self, encoder, decoder, kl_weighting=1, **kwargs):
super(VAE, self).__init__(**kwargs)
self.encoder = encoder
self.decoder = decoder
self.kl_weighting = kl_weighting
self.total_loss_tracker = keras.metrics.Mean(name="total_loss")
self.reconstruction_loss_tracker = keras.metrics.Mean(
name="reconstruction_loss"
)
self.kl_loss_tracker = keras.metrics.Mean(name="kl_loss")
@property
def metrics(self):
return [
self.total_loss_tracker,
self.reconstruction_loss_tracker,
self.kl_loss_tracker,
]
def train_step(self, data):
with tf.GradientTape() as tape:
z_mean, z_log_var, z = self.encoder(data)
reconstruction = self.decoder(z)
reconstruction_loss = reconstruction_loss_fn(data, reconstruction)
kl_loss = kl_loss_fn(z_mean, z_log_var, self.kl_weighting)
total_loss = reconstruction_loss + kl_loss
grads = tape.gradient(total_loss, self.trainable_weights)
self.optimizer.apply_gradients(zip(grads, self.trainable_weights))
self.total_loss_tracker.update_state(total_loss)
self.reconstruction_loss_tracker.update_state(reconstruction_loss)
self.kl_loss_tracker.update_state(kl_loss)
return {
"loss": self.total_loss_tracker.result(),
"reconstruction_loss": self.reconstruction_loss_tracker.result(),
"kl_loss": self.kl_loss_tracker.result(),
}
models_dict = {"shapes3d": build_encoder_decoder_large}
